On the Bubble? Where TV Shows Stand Now

By this time next month, the Fall TV schedule will be set.

By this time next month, the Fall TV schedule will be set. Starting with NBC in a couple of weeks, each network will piece together its programming slate, including which current series will return and which new pilots will get a shot at success. That means it's crunch time for shows that are "on the bubble," with equally good chances they'll get renewed or canceled. The Hollywood Reporter broke down which series have a good shot at returning and which look dead, and a few tidbits jumped out to me as I read its take:

  • Good news, bad news at the CW. This line set off a rollercoaster of emotions: "Over at the CW, Reaper is gone, while the prospects for Privileged have improved, and the show is now considered for a possible midseason order." Reaper had been holding its own against American Idol, so I'm surprised the CW would dismiss it so quickly, but at least we've gotten two seasons of it. Privileged definitely seems like it deserves another shot — especially if it could air during one of these extended breaks from Gossip Girl.
  • A bunch of shows are really 50/50. Among the ones considered true toss-ups: Chuck (whose chances are said to be hurt by Southland's early success but whose fans are vocal), Dollhouse, and CBS's Without a Trace and Cold Case — of which only one is expected to return.
  • Good news for some midseason shows. Even though none of ABC's midseason shows have been blockbuster hits, Better Off Ted, Castle, and The Unusuals are all considered possibilities to return next year. (Cupid, however, seems dead already.)
  • Say farewell to . . . In addition to Cupid and Reaper, things are reportedly not looking good for Life,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les, or Eleventh Hour.

2009 Fall New York Fashion Week: A Few Fab Words With . . . Privileged Star Joanna Garcia at BCBG

I know you all love some BCBG, and guess who does too?

I know you all love some BCBG, and guess who does too? Privileged star Joanna Garcia. I chatted with her front row at the show, and a new girl crush started to develop. Before I take you into the mind of Joanna — the clothes. They were architectural and fluid, hard and soft. Colors ranged from ivory to dusty wineberry to teal to steel gray. BCBG focused on the future and constructivism. I'll pass on the cocoon-like coats, but the fluid dresses always make me melt. Fabrics were diverse: wool jacquard, silk, micro jersey, and velvet. The shibori-dyed items piqued my interest, delivering an exotic side of BCBG. What really made the clothes shine, though, were the hypnotizing gold and pewter legging tights; now those were future chic.

Here's what Joanna and I chatted about:

We have a website called CelebStyle.com where we cover your Privileged wardrobe.

"Yeah, I know! It's so great. The girls have much more fun stuff on there, but I definitely love looking at all that stuff; I think it's such a great website."

Can you talk about your wardrobe on the show?

"My wardrobe is pretty basic. Cute tops, and sweaters, and jeans, stuff like that. Very much my everyday style. The other girls have a lot more fun. I actually helped design an original dress for our season finale. It took three fittings, and I was like 'This is for the birds! This is a lot of work,' so I leave the high fashion to the other girls. It was absolutely beautiful though. It was made for me, and I’ve never had that before, except my prom dress when I was 17 and it didn't turn out as nice."
